> I was trying to look up a module, and, after installing matplotlib
> 0.98.1, I get:

>   File "/opt/lib/python2.5/site-packages/matplotlib/config/
> tconfig.py", line 391, in __init__
>     raise TConfigInvalidKeyError(m)
> matplotlib.config.tconfig.TConfigInvalidKeyError: In config defined in
> file: '/opt/lib/python2.5/site-packages/matplotlib/mpl-data/
> matplotlib.conf'
> Error processing section: figure
> These keys are invalid : ['autolayout']
> Valid key names        : ['edgecolor', 'facecolor', 'dpi', 'figsize']

This looks like you have the experimental "traited config" turned on,
and Michael may have not cleaned autolayout from the tconfig defaults
when he removed it.  Did you build from source or get your package
from elsewhere.  If building from source, edit setup.cfg next to
setup.py and make sure that the traited config is off

  ## Experimental config package support, this should only be enabled by
  ## matplotlib developers, for matplotlib development
  enthought.traits = False
  configobj = False

If you got it from elsewhere, let the packager know this should be
